Output e96a3a42e3bcdc172f4e7c3c242f21f8460c2957e4591fae426d55bfce00c875:34

value
236365
script pubkey
OP_0 OP_PUSHBYTES_32 f2851f9c9d39f25f18e0e46dcbe362bebcb7d1eae459c1b40e2fded351f13c6a
address
bc1q72z3l8ya88e97x8qu3kuhcmzh67t0502u3vurdqw9l0dx503834qzpfd8d
transaction
e96a3a42e3bcdc172f4e7c3c242f21f8460c2957e4591fae426d55bfce00c875
confirmations
17063
spent
true